I recently decided to close my email account and subsequently removed this email address from Thunderbird. As a result I realised I'd lost all my mail folders attached to this address, which are important to me.

I've had the account reinstated, but no longer have my mail folders. How can I find them?

Was the removed account set up as POP or IMAP account? In Thunderbird go to Help > Troubleshooting Information > Profile Folder > Open Folder, then quit TB. In the TB profile folder- named somewhat like "xxxxxxxx.default-esr" or similar - first open the folder "Mail". ìf you see a subfolder "pop.xxx.xx" open it and take a screen shot of its content. If there is a folder "ImapMail" in the profile folder, open it and show its content in a screen shot
